What is metal weight?

Metal weight tells the mass or heaviness of a metal object. It calculates the amount of metal present in an item.  It tells to a class of elements characterized by their high electrical and thermal conductivity, malleability, and generally different appearance.

 

Metal weight can be shown in different units of measurement. For instance, grams, kilograms, pounds, or tons, according to the system of measurement being used. It is an important aspect to consider in various domains, including manufacturing, construction, and engineering.

Formula:

Metal Weight = (Equivalent Weight of Metal B × Weight of Metal A) / Weight of Metal B

Types of metal

Here few types of metal with their characteristics are discussed.

Metal

Characteristics

Aluminum

Lightweight, corrosion-resistant, and commonly used in construction, transportation, and packaging.

Copper

Excellent electrical and thermal conductivity, used in electrical wiring, plumbing, and electronics.

Steel

An alloy of iron and carbon, with varying amounts of other elements.

Iron

Durable and strong, used in construction, machinery, and automotive applications.

Brass

An alloy of copper and zinc, known for its corrosion resistance and attractive appearance.

Nickel

Resistant to corrosion and high temperatures, used in alloys for turbine blades, electrical resistance wires, and batteries.

Zinc

Corrosion-resistant, often used as a protective coating for other metals, and also used in batteries and alloys.

Silver

Excellent electrical conductivity and high reflectivity, used in electrical contacts, jewelry, and photography.

Gold:

Highly malleable, ductile, and resistant to tarnish. Valued for jewelry, electronics, and investment purposes.

How to calculate metal weight?

Example 1:

Determine the Metal Weight when

Weight of Metal A = 23

Equivalent Weight of Metal B = 51

Weight of Metal B = 42

Solution

Step 1:

Using the formula mentioned below to calculate metal weight

Metal Weight = (Equivalent Weight of Metal B × Weight of Metal A) / Weight of Metal B

Step 2:

Inserting the values

Metal Weight = (51 × 23) / 42

Metal Weight = 1173 / 42

Metal Weight = 27.9285
